In 2023, the landscape of export markets for wholesale suppliers is more dynamic than ever. Identifying key markets that promise growth is essential for businesses looking to scale their operations.
Southeast Asia continues to emerge as a lucrative market for wholesale suppliers, driven by a growing middle class and increasing consumer spending.
Countries in Latin America, particularly Brazil and Chile, offer vibrant opportunities for suppliers in sectors such as agriculture and technology.
The European market remains robust, with demand for high-quality products and strong regulatory frameworks appealing to manufacturers worldwide.
Africa is becoming an increasingly important market, especially in sectors like textiles and consumer goods, driven by urbanization and population growth.
The U.S. and Canada continue to be prime destinations for export suppliers, particularly in technology, health products, and renewable energy.
For wholesale suppliers, understanding these markets can unlock significant growth opportunities. Engaging with local partners and adapting strategies to meet regional demands will be critical.
